Major Mathew McClurg departed Eielson Air Force Base with the 168th crew headed for Royal Air Force Mildenhall AFB, United Kingdom, to participate in NATO Exercise Steadfast Noon as a Major. Honoring his time as an enlisted member and remembering his roots as a crew chief, McClurg decided to be promoted to Lt. Col. in flight aboard a KC-135 Stratotanker.
The promotion order for McClurg had come in earlier in the month, and he was awaiting a ceremony to "make it official." McClurg returned to the Alaska Air National Guard after retiring in 2019 and was elated to see the promotion order in early October.
McClurg saw the opportunity to have the ceremony on board the flight to Mildenhall since the 168th Maintenance Group Commander, Col. Jennifer Casillo, was also going to be aboard the flight. She thought the idea sounded unique and fun, especially upon the return from retirement of Major McClurg, and she agreed to do the in-flight ceremony.
After a bit of a delayed launch from the 168th Wing Campus at Eielson, the aircraft took off and began the long flight.
About an hour into the flight, Casillo went to McClurg and said, "your crew is ready to promote you! Let's do this!"
They positioned themselves in the front of the cargo compartment of the KC-135 and had one of the Crew Chiefs hold an American Flag in the background and started the ceremony. Even though most attendees could not hear the promotion order and the oath over the background noise of the aircraft flying at 30,000 feet between Alaska and England, the crew knew what the ceremony entailed and rallied around the two Commanders as it took place.
Once completed, the reception and congratulatory welcome to newly promoted Lt. Col. McClurg was filled with smiles and high fives. After the ceremony, snacks and homemade banana bread were enjoyed over the jet's baggage bins, and the team knew this was something unique and special.
